Class: College Prep Biology Unit: “Genetics” Topic: DNA’s job requirements
Instructional Objectives: Students should be able to…
Students will list the main roles of DNA
Copying info
Storing info
Transmitting info
Students will identify the four bases within a DNA strand as well at other structural molecules
Students will be able to identify and replicate the double helix structure of DNA
Opening: "Who can remind me what the roles of DNA are? Why is DNA so imporntant?" "Today we will take a deeper look into DNA and observe its main parts and structure to understand how it works a bit better."
